A08 (Glyphosate Aptamer) Aptamer Details
ID# 8583
Structure
Chemistry
DNA
Target
Glyphosate
Category
Small Organic
Affinity (Kd)
LOD: 0.6 µM
Length
84
Aptazyme
No

Molecular Weight: 25921.7 g/mole
Extinction Coefficient: 781000
Binding Conditions / Buffer
qPCR detection assay from magnetic bead preparation in tap water / deionized water.
Previous work used 10 mM Tris-HCl.
Binding Temp: RT°C

Reference
Shao Y, Tian R, Duan J, Wang M, Cao J, Cao Z, Li G, Jin F, Abd El-Aty AM, She Y. A Novel Fluorescent Sensor Based on Aptamer and qPCR for Determination of Glyphosate in Tap Water. Sensors. 2023; 23(2):649. https://doi.org/10.3390/s23020649
Patent: CN105039347A
